Hymn: Great God thy penetrating eye (FL)

Hymnal: New Christian Hymn and Tune Book

Date: 1882

Compiler: Fillmore Brothers

Publisher/Printer: Fillmore Brothers

First Line: Great God thy penetrating eye

Topic: God/Omnipresence

Writer: E Scott

Composer: Hugh Wilson

Meter: CM

Tune: Avon

Hymn Number: 245

Lyics

GREAT God! thy penetrating eye
Pervades my inmost powers;
With awe profound my wondering soul
Falls prostrate and adores.


To be encompassed round with God,
The Holy and the Just,
Armed with omnipotence to save,
Or crush me to the dust-


O how tremendous is the thought!
Deep may it be impressed;
And may thy Spirit firmly grave
This truth within my breast.


Begirt with thee, my fearless soul
The gloomy vale shall tread;
And thou wilt bind th' immortal crown
Of glory on my head.
